The Mercator Distortion
Developed in 1569, the Mercator projection was designed for nautical navigation. It stretches landmasses toward the poles, making high‑latitude regions appear larger than they really are. For example, Greenland looks almost as big as Africa, even though Africa’s land area is fourteen times greater. This actual size of countries on map misrepresentation persists in most school atlases and online maps, shaping unconscious biases about wealth, power, and geography.

Visualizing Real Areas
Several modern mapping projects aim to correct the distortion. The #green land projection and other equal‑area visualizations keep country shapes recognizable while presenting their true surface. These tools use mathematical formulas to preserve area, allowing viewers to compare nations side by side without the misleading scale of Mercator.
For a quick experiment, try overlaying a globe onto a flat surface. When you flatten a sphere, some distortion is inevitable, but equal‑area projections minimize it enough for educational purposes.
